The first S. aureus strain with a vancomycin MIC 8 mg/L was isolated in 1996 from a Japanese patient to whom vancomycin therapy was ineffective [1]. Subsequently, dozens of VRSA strains were isolated from USA, France, Korea, South Africa, Scotland and Brazil [2], indicating that the issue is a global one [3]. Heteroresistance refers to the presence, within a large population of antimicrobial-susceptible microorganisms, of subpopulations with lesser susceptibilities. Ceftaroline is a novel cephalosporin with activity against meth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A). Microbial resistance has reached alarming levels, threatening to outpace the ability to counter with more potent antimicrobial agents. In particular, meth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) has become a leading cause of skin and soft-tissue infections and PVL-positive strains have been associated with necrotizing pneumonia.
